Audio and Video Technicians Salary in Athens-Clarke County, GA

The median pay for a audio and video technicians in Athens-Clarke County, GA is $34,620/year ($16.64/hour), per BLS data. The range runs from $35K at the entry level to $61K for experienced workers. Cost of living is below average (RPP 93.34), which stretches that salary to about $37,090 in buying power. A 2-bedroom apartment runs $1,331/month — about 56.4% of take-home, which is tight.

Frequently asked questions

How much do audio and video technicians make in Athens-Clarke County, GA?

The median is $34,620 a year, that works out to about $17 an hour. But the range is wide: entry-level workers start around $34,620, and experienced audio and video technicians can clear $60,660. These are BLS numbers, based on employer-reported data, not self-reported surveys.

Is $35K enough to live in Athens-Clarke County?

On that salary, you'd take home roughly $2,367/month after taxes. A 2-bedroom here rents for about $1,331/month, which eats 56.2% of your paycheck. That's above the 30% rule of thumb, housing will be a stretch at the median salary, though you can manage with roommates or a smaller place.

How far does a audio and video technicians salary go in Athens-Clarke County?

Athens-Clarke County has a Regional Price Parity of 93.34 (100 is the national average). That's below average, your money stretches further here than the raw salary number suggests. After cost-of-living adjustment, the median audio and video technicians salary is worth about $37,090 in national-average purchasing power.
